Observation Date: 02/01/2020

Route/Location:
SE Bowl Little St. Joe

Weather:
High winds out of the South and West and well above freezing. Overnight freeze line about 7400′. Wind in the SE bowl was swirling around and upsloping leaving no aspect unmarred. Wind was so strong it knocked me off my feet and we witnessed numerous trees getting blown over throughout the day.

Other Comments:
The number one concern of the day was falling trees. We had four trees blow down in close proximity to us during gusts. The trail was a mess of broken branches and blowdown for most of the entire way up. Alot of work with a saw will be warranted to clear it all completely.

The combination of wind affected snow, breakable meltfreeze crust or wet, warm snow made linking turns while skiing a challenge and conditions could be described as variable at best.
